Factors to Consider When Choosing Mobile Hot Holding Cabinet

Choosing the right mobile hot holding cabinet involves evaluating several key factors that impact your workflow and operational needs. Beyond price, consider how capacity, insulation, and portability align with your daily demands. A well-chosen cabinet can improve efficiency, food safety, and presentation, but a poor fit can lead to wasted space or compromised food quality. Here are the critical considerations to keep in mind when making your selection.

Capacity and Size

Determine how much food you need to hold at once, as capacity varies widely among models. Smaller units are easier to move and fit into tight spaces, but may require more frequent restocking. Larger, full-size options accommodate more food but are heavier and less portable. Consider your typical volume and space constraints to find a balance that suits your operation without sacrificing mobility or capacity.

Insulation and Heat Retention

Quality insulation is critical for maintaining consistent temperatures, especially during transport or long holding periods. Thin or poorly insulated cabinets can cause heat loss, increasing energy costs and risking food safety. Heavy-duty materials like aluminum and well-designed insulation layers help ensure food stays at the desired temperature without excessive energy use.

Mobility and Durability

Since these cabinets are meant to be moved frequently, look for features like sturdy wheels, handles, and a lightweight yet durable construction. Heavy-duty aluminum frames tend to last longer under rough conditions but may be more expensive. Consider how often you need to move the unit and the environment in which it will be used to select a model that balances portability with longevity.

Ease of Use and Controls

Features like analog controls, digital temperature readouts, and glass doors enhance operational ease. Analog controls are simple and reliable but less precise, while digital controls offer more accuracy and programmability. Glass doors allow quick visual checks, saving time during busy service. Weigh these usability features against your budget and maintenance preferences.

Price and Value

While high-end models offer advanced features and robust construction, they come with higher costs. Budget options may lack durability or capacity, leading to higher long-term expenses. Focus on models that meet your core needs without overspending on features that won’t be used frequently. Investing in quality often pays off in reliability and lower maintenance costs over time.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I use a mobile hot holding cabinet outdoors?

Most mobile hot holding cabinets are designed for indoor use, with limited weatherproofing. Using one outdoors may expose it to moisture, dust, and temperature extremes that can damage internal components or reduce efficiency. If outdoor use is necessary, look for models explicitly rated for outdoor environments or ensure adequate protection and shelter to prevent potential damage.

How long can food stay safely in a hot holding cabinet?

Food can generally stay safe in a hot holding cabinet for 2-4 hours if the temperature is maintained above 140°F (60°C). However, the exact safe duration depends on the food type, initial temperature, and cabinet performance. Regular monitoring and proper cleaning are essential to ensure food safety during extended holding times.

Is it worth paying extra for a glass door?

Glass doors provide quick visual access, saving time and reducing door openings, which helps maintain steady temperatures. They are especially useful in busy settings where frequent checks are needed. However, glass can be more fragile and might compromise insulation slightly, potentially affecting efficiency. Consider your operational flow when deciding if the added convenience justifies the cost.

What material is best for durability in a mobile hot holding cabinet?

Heavy-duty aluminum is a common choice due to its lightweight yet durable nature, resisting corrosion and impacts better than some plastics or thinner metals. Steel frames offer extra strength but tend to be heavier and more prone to corrosion if not treated properly. The right choice depends on your usage frequency and environment—aluminum often strikes a good balance for most mobile applications.

How important are controls and temperature accuracy?

Accurate controls are vital for maintaining consistent food temperatures, especially during long holding periods. Digital controls often allow for precise adjustments and easier monitoring, reducing energy waste. Analog controls are simpler but less precise, which can be problematic for delicate or temperature-sensitive foods. Your choice should align with your operational needs and desired level of control.
